  • Abstract
    The letter presents an echo canceller employing both delta modulation (DM) and a least-mean-square (LMS) adaptive filter. An adaptive filter operating on a DM binary output sequence attempts to model the echo path. This tandem connection can significantly reduce the hardware complexity. The proposed scheme appears to have considerable potential in telecommunications as the results are comparable to those obtained from the classical echo canceller with PCM.
